当前位置: 首页> 学位论文 >详情
原文传递 基于LFMCW的车辆检测雷达的FPGA信号处理设计与实现
论文题名: 基于LFMCW的车辆检测雷达的FPGA信号处理设计与实现
关键词: 车辆检测雷达;信号处理系统;FPGA;CSI-2协议;Keystone变换
摘要: 在现代社会,随着智能化高速公路交通管理的飞速发展,交通道路的信息采集技术显得尤为重要,而线性调频连续波(LFMCW)雷达因其距离分辨能力高,抗干扰能力强等优点为高速公路车辆目标检测提供了思路。本文完成了基于LFMCW的车辆检测雷达的FPGA信号处理系统的设计与算法实现,适用于高速公路车辆检测的场景。
  本论文主要完成了以下几项工作:
  (1)完成了系统方案的设计与仿真。首先分析了任务需求和参数指标,然后根据LFMCW雷达的工作原理,结合实际情况给出了车辆目标检测雷达信号处理的完整的信号处理流程。其中分别使用Keystone算法和速度模糊数补偿解决了高速公路车辆目标检测中遇到的距离走动问题和速度模糊问题,最后在MATLAB环境下编写程序进行仿真实验,验证了整个信号处理流程的可行性。
  (2)设计了系统硬件电路。通过多个不同角度的分析,确定了硬件整体设计方案。从芯片选型、功能实现和设计注意事项三个方面对各个模块的电路设计作了说明,其中包括FPGA芯片、电源模块、时钟模块、DSP模块、接口模块以及DDR3模块。
  (3)实现了基于FPGA的CSI-2接口通信。首先对CSI-2通信协议的协议机制进行了详细的分析,随后采用模块化的思想,将整体通信功能分割为发送模块、接收解包模块以及数据重组打包模块三个子模块来实现。在发送模块中,借助FIFO解决了输入数据侧和D-PHY侧间的跨时钟域问题。
  (4)完成了信号处理算法的FPGA硬件实现。基于理论仿真部分给出的系统设计方案,在FPGA硬件电路上完成对系统设计方案的具体实现和高效优化。从功能分析,功能实现、仿真时序验证三个方面对FPGA硬件实现中的主要子模块包括初始化配置模块、DBF波束形成模块、SRIO通信模块、数据重排模块、Keystone变换运算模块、速度模糊数补偿以及脉压/MTD处理模块作了详细的说明。其中针对Keystone变换系数生成所常用的查找表法中存在的资源消耗问题,设计了一种查找表与CORDIC核相结合的系数生成方案,降低了硬件的资源消耗。
  本文设计的基于LFMCW的车辆检测雷达的FPGA信号处理系统,实现了对高速公路目标的实时检测,并解决了使用传统雷达探测方法,探测高速车辆目标时存在的距离走动与速度模糊问题,通过射频模拟板对信号处理系统上各个功能模块的验证与测试,其基本完成了数据传输与信号处理的功能。
作者: 黄璇
专业: 通信与信息系统
导师: 顾红
授予学位: 硕士
授予学位单位: 南京理工大学
学位年度: 2020
检索历史
应用推荐